Frequently asked

Common questions

Which has a higher profit split — Axi Select or The Funded Trader?
Axi Select pays 90%; The Funded Trader pays 90% of trader profits once funded. Both firms offer the same profit share.
Is Axi Select cheaper to start than The Funded Trader?
Axi Select: evaluation from Free. The Funded Trader: evaluation from $59–$1,599 one-time.
Which pays out faster — Axi Select or The Funded Trader?
Axi Select payouts: Monthly. The Funded Trader payouts: Bi-weekly. First-payout eligibility: Axi Select — Monthly; The Funded Trader — 14 days after first funded trade.
What's the maximum allocation at Axi Select vs The Funded Trader?
Axi Select scales up to $1,000,000. The Funded Trader scales up to $600,000.
Can I trade news at Axi Select or The Funded Trader?
Axi Select: permits news trading. The Funded Trader: permits news trading.
Can I hold positions overnight at Axi Select or The Funded Trader?
Axi Select: allows overnight holds. The Funded Trader: allows overnight holds.
